Methodology software engineering and requirements gathering

The elicitation step is where the requirements are first gathered from the client many techniques are available for gathering requirements each has value in certain circumstances, and in many cases, you need multiple techniques to gain a complete picture from a diverse set of clients and stakeholders. In systems engineering and software engineering, requirements analysis encompasses those tasks that go into determining the needs or conditions to meet for a new or altered product or project, taking account of the possibly conflicting requirements of the various stakeholders, analyzing, documenting, validating and managing software or system requirements. Techniques for requirements gathering and definition kristian persson principal product specialist. Conceptually, requirements analysis includes three types of activities: [citation needed] eliciting requirements: (eg the project charter or definition), business process documentation, and stakeholder interviews this is sometimes also called requirements gathering or requirements discovery.

Requirements gathering methods in system engineering radek silhavy, petr silhavy, zdenka prokopova scope of system and software engineering [1,7] the interview is origin for social science research it is requirements gathering process the requirements engineering process contains. In systems engineering and software engineering, requirements analysis encompasses those tasks that go into determining the needs or conditions to meet for a new or altered product or project, taking account of the possibly conflicting requirements of the various stakeholders, analyzing, documenting, validating and managing software or system requirements requirements analysis is critical to the success or failure of a systems or software project.

Many techniques are available for gathering requirements each has value in certain circumstances, and in many cases, you need multiple techniques to gain a complete picture from a diverse set of. The process to gather the software requirements from client, analyze and document them is known as requirement engineering the goal of requirement engineering is to develop and maintain sophisticated and descriptive ‘system requirements specification’ document. Eliciting, collecting, and developing requirements print lines between the project’s strategy and the software’s implementation methodology sometimes blur the software development life cycle (sdlc) is a process methodology for software development joint (users, developers, integrators, systems engineering) requirements gathering. Joint (users, developers, integrators, systems engineering) requirements gathering sessions are frequently one of the most powerful techniques for eliciting requirements when ses analyze related documents, system interfaces, and data, they are likely to discover new requirements.

Requirements gathering sdlc is an acronym for software development lifecycle and is the process used as the framework for software development project managers and business organizations use the. There are many business requirements gathering techniques available and many keeps on evolving as the time passes and the need arises if you know the essential gathering techniques in advance then you can very well determine which one will work best for your business project. Requirements gathering can be a difficult, exhaustive process we've assembled information on the best methods for requirements engineering -- prototypes, storyboards, models, state transition diagrams and use cases -- in one guide.

Methodology software engineering and requirements gathering

Software engineering methodology: the watersluice a dissertation submitted to the department of computer science and the committee on graduate studies. For a requirements jad session, the participants stay in session until a complete set of requirements is documented and agreed to #5: questionnaires questionnaires are much more informal, and they are good tools to gather requirements from stakeholders in remote locations or those who will have only minor input into the overall requirements.

Process approach to requirements gathering written by mani ramasarma this blog was supposed to be on requirements elicitation techniques, but it ended up being an example of what peer review does. A software development methodology or system development methodology in software engineering is a framework that is used to structure, plan, and control the process of developing an information system. Requirement gathering techniques are helpful for every business, particularly when you know which one of them are most important and can help you increase your company's profit and business there are many business requirements gathering techniques available and many keeps on evolving as the time passes and the need arises.

When it comes to business requirements gathering, various techniques are available every techniques comes with its own merits and demerits requirements workshop reverse engineering survey slide 2 of 11 1 brainstorming interviews of users and stakeholders are important in creating wonderful software without knowing the. Many techniques are available for gathering requirements each has value in certain circumstances, and in many cases, you need multiple techniques to gain a complete picture from a diverse set of clients and stakeholders. Agile requirements gathering in embedded project [duplicate] we try to use scrum process but came across different difficulties related to our and management team perception of requirements engineering requirement gathering in an agile methodology 2.

methodology software engineering and requirements gathering A software development methodology or system development methodology in software engineering is a framework that  there are a number of agile software development methodologies eg  it produces its savings by shortening the elapsed time required to gather a system's requirements and by gathering requirements better, thus reducing the. methodology software engineering and requirements gathering A software development methodology or system development methodology in software engineering is a framework that  there are a number of agile software development methodologies eg  it produces its savings by shortening the elapsed time required to gather a system's requirements and by gathering requirements better, thus reducing the. methodology software engineering and requirements gathering A software development methodology or system development methodology in software engineering is a framework that  there are a number of agile software development methodologies eg  it produces its savings by shortening the elapsed time required to gather a system's requirements and by gathering requirements better, thus reducing the.
Methodology software engineering and requirements gathering
Rated 3/5 based on 16 review
Download

2018.